当多个客户对同类消息感兴趣时,人们建议使用signalR组 . 我有点好奇,这个概念在内部如何运作 . 为什么通过SignalR组向多个客户端发送消息比将其发送到单个客户端更快?
有关SignalR如何工作的详细信息,请参阅以下链接 -
http://www.asp.net/signalr/overview/getting-started/real-time-web-applications-with-signalr
我不确定是否有足够明显的性能差异,能够发送给个人需要更多的编码,因为你应该为这个额外的代码层获取他们的connectionId和代码,而不是仅仅将它们转储到自己的代码中组,并且即使它只包含一个客户端,也会向该组广播 .
2 回答
有关SignalR如何工作的详细信息,请参阅以下链接 -
http://www.asp.net/signalr/overview/getting-started/real-time-web-applications-with-signalr
我不确定是否有足够明显的性能差异,能够发送给个人需要更多的编码,因为你应该为这个额外的代码层获取他们的connectionId和代码,而不是仅仅将它们转储到自己的代码中组,并且即使它只包含一个客户端,也会向该组广播 .